We moved into our house last winter. My husband and I live on the ground floor with our baby daughter and we have rooms upstairs for family when they stay.

When my mum stayed for a while shortly after we moved, she said that every now and then in the upstairs room, she smelt a strong tobacco smell, as if someone who smoked very heavily had passed her. But it was not there all the time. I’d never smelt it and shrugged it off.

Months have past and I’ve never smelt it until a few weeks ago when I went into our lounge one morning and it stunk of cigarettes! Opened all the windows and put an air freshener in. It took 2 days to go. Then nothing until yesterday.

Sitting in the lounge having morning tea with my husband and it suddenly wafts past us. Both smell it and it’s really strong, but then gone. We both look at each other and try to come up with an explanation, something under the floorboards? The heat bringing it out of the walls? Fire damaged carpet?

In the evening my husband comes into the bedroom from the office which is situated at the far end of the house, no where near the living room to tell me it was in there when he got his laptop.

We’re still trying to come up with explanations. My husband and mother do not smoke, if I do it’s once in a blue moon on a night out so certainly never in the house! No one would smoke in the house, and we don’t have that many guests here that it would ever happen without us knowing.

Has anyone experienced anything like this? It’s so strong, then just vanishes.
